What’s the point of tobacco control? Comment on Dan Halliday, ‘The ethics of a smoking licence’
Sales taxes have become a central feature of anti-smoking initiatives across the world. Dan Halliday provides a strong argument in favour of smoking licences as an alternative to suchtaxes.[1] I agree with much of Dan’s argument.
